The problem is continuing to have the conference championship games under this system. They are unnecessary and create more harm than good. Sometimes winning them helps you (see Indiana). Sometimes it doesn't (see Georgia). Sometimes losing them hurts your (see BYU). Sometimes it doesn't (see Alabama and, to a lesser extent, Ohio State). Sometimes you win and "lose" (see Georgia last year who lost their starting QB).
They were ALWAYS, from day 1, made for tv money grabs. That's it. College football operated just fine without them for decades. However, in the days of the BCS and, to some degree, the 4 team CFP, they in some cases operated a defacto playoff games. That is not the case anymore where in many instances the two teams playing in the conf. champ game would be at large CFP teams if the conf. champ games weren't played. A team like BYU shouldn't be penalized for being forced to play an extra game. On the flip side, a team like Miami shouldn't be rewarded for NOT having to play an extra game.
The other thing is to stop the weekly CFP polls. All it does is create irrational explanations where none would have been necessary had there not been a weekly CFP poll. On Dec. 2 Notre Dame is ranked ahead of Miami. Then, a week later, despite neither team playing a game, Miami is suddenly ranked ahead of ND? If you want to say that's because Miami beat ND head to head, then I agree. But if that mattered at the end why didn't it seem to matter a week before?
